Cleaning
the
Nozzle
Turn cleaner OFF and disconnect
from electrical
out{et.
The cleaner's nozzle (E) can be
removed for easy cleaning.
Slide the two nozzle release latches
(F) outward.
Remove nozzle (E) by pulling straight
out.
Rinse nozzle under running water.
Remove debris from squeegee (G)
and wipe with a damp cloth.
To replace nozzle, make sure latches
are out.
Align middle section (H) of nozzle
with opening (I) on cleaner.
\
While holding nozzle in place, slide
latches inward to lock in place.
Sterage
Before storing cleaner:
Turn cleaner OFF and disconnect
from electricaJ outJet.
,, Empty and rinse solution and recov-
ery tanks. Allow to air dry.
o Allow filter in recovery tank lid to
dry.
o Set the cleaner for "Dry Vacuuming"
(pedal to "DRY" and Wet Control
switch up).
,, Make sure that nothing is pressing
on the nozzle squeegee.
o Do not store cleaner on a wood sur-
face unless cleaner is compJetely
dry.
